Table 1.

Analysis of wild-type, SHIP-1−/−, Mev/Mev, and Lyn−/− mouse HCT, spleen weight, and BM and spleen cellularity


Genotype (no. mice)

HCT, %

Spleen weight, g

Spleen cellularity, × 106

BM cellularity/femur, × 106
Wild-type (8)   52.4 ± 1.6   0.085 ± 0.012   135 ± 53   17.0 ± 2.1  
SHIP-1−/− (7)   50.8 ± 4.6   0.213 ± 0.064   300 ± 93   13.4 ± 3.0  
Mev/Mev (4-6)   43.7 ± 3.7   0.236 ± 0.091   298 ± 124   4.3 ± 0.9  
Lyn−/− (5)
 
50.1 ± 2.4
 
0.087 ± 0.019
 
117 ± 9
 
18.2 ± 1.9

All characterization was performed on mice of 6 to 8 weeks of age. Hematocrit (HCT) was determined by analysis of blood obtained from the retro-orbital venous plexus on an ADVIA 120 hematology system. Values represent the mean ± SD for the number of mice indicated.
